ThomasV
37d5e3b42a
version 2.3.3, release notes
2015-06-26 14:35:22 +02:00
ThomasV
fdd43bd5ad
fix issue in f307b18546
2015-06-24 09:35:54 +02:00
ThomasV
f307b18546
Merge pull request #1268 from kyuupichan/blockchain_nothread
...
Make the blockchain class not a thread
2015-06-24 09:00:52 +02:00
ThomasV
56f8fc62f9
fix 1312
2015-06-23 16:58:21 +02:00
ThomasV
f894af90d7
fix deserialize_proxy. fixes #1309
2015-06-23 14:22:10 +02:00
ThomasV
74d26f5bdc
better error message
2015-06-15 10:52:03 +02:00
ThomasV
0682695da9
version 2.3.2
2015-06-14 11:39:41 +02:00
ThomasV
00af3b394b
Merge pull request #1280 from kyuupichan/BIP-LI01
...
Implement BIP-LI01.
2015-06-14 08:08:55 +02:00
ThomasV
ec9cdfaf48
blockchain: restore call to set_local_height, forgotten in previous commit
2015-06-13 16:45:42 +02:00
ThomasV
d09a10e0f7
fix is_used for unmatured tx
2015-06-13 16:40:50 +02:00
Roman Zeyde
90076b0b79
util: add print_msg() method to DaemonThread
...
it is used by at synchornizer.py, line 173
2015-06-13 16:58:08 +03:00
Roman Zeyde
c324d21107
transaction: added missing import
...
for "traceback.print_exc(file=sys.stdout)" statement at line 361
2015-06-13 16:58:08 +03:00
Roman Zeyde
cb4d3a78b4
verifier: fix typo
2015-06-13 16:58:08 +03:00
ThomasV
12feb4cf9c
Merge pull request #1294 from romanz/master
...
bitcoin: remove dead code
2015-06-13 13:25:28 +02:00
Roman Zeyde
6bb9ee0cf7
bitcoin: remove dead code
2015-06-13 08:34:56 +03:00
ThomasV
7a3ddfc6a4
version 2.3.1
2015-06-12 20:22:02 +02:00
ThomasV
10740470cc
fix requests_dir bug
2015-06-12 20:18:06 +02:00
ThomasV
d75d3fdf5b
fix --pending option
2015-06-12 20:15:53 +02:00
ThomasV
42084a3610
improve docstrings
2015-06-12 10:34:45 +02:00
ThomasV
1fbbd5d65d
require network to show request status
2015-06-12 09:58:29 +02:00
ThomasV
cbcb799eec
add filtering options for listrequests
2015-06-12 09:46:21 +02:00
ThomasV
f3597f865b
--force option for addrequest
2015-06-11 20:44:38 +02:00
ThomasV
db6c69f0da
Merge pull request #1289 from Kefkius/patch-1
...
Fix typo in param_descriptions
2015-06-11 13:47:06 +02:00
ThomasV
a103f59686
new flags for listaddresses
2015-06-11 12:49:14 +02:00
ThomasV
317a9de71d
check amount before calling make_payment_request
2015-06-11 12:32:52 +02:00
ThomasV
ba78093e2e
getalias: no check
2015-06-11 12:08:38 +02:00
Kefkius
b6e4013a9d
Fix typo in param_descriptions
...
heigh --> height
2015-06-11 04:55:08 -04:00
ThomasV
e5b5e8d0f4
comment our ackrequest
2015-06-11 10:50:25 +02:00
ThomasV
d6cdc085ea
fix #1283
2015-06-11 10:03:26 +02:00
ThomasV
16344b43af
fix issue #1282
2015-06-11 08:56:07 +02:00
ThomasV
e31ac7905d
Clear address cache when interface changes. Send requests only if interface is connected.
2015-06-11 02:10:06 +02:00
Neil Booth
28f440350d
Fix request handling.
...
Handle local requests immediately.
Defer those requiring connectivity until we have an interface.
2015-06-11 08:31:19 +09:00
ThomasV
5714d9f4fc
shorter docstrings
2015-06-10 23:48:36 +02:00
ThomasV
145bf5cf0a
rename decodetx and sendtx commands. merge mktx and payto commands.
2015-06-10 23:21:25 +02:00
ThomasV
e067e34313
make global options: -w and -o
2015-06-10 22:29:31 +02:00
ThomasV
2b9b42d5f7
Merge pull request #1286 from kyuupichan/remove_urllib2
...
Use requests instead - SSL handling is superior
2015-06-10 21:15:27 +02:00
ThomasV
e517321f76
Network: fix handle_requests, must process requests even if we are not connected
2015-06-10 18:26:03 +02:00
ThomasV
6ea04e2d47
Network: Fix switch_to_interface (check that interface is connected)
2015-06-10 18:24:57 +02:00
ThomasV
060e3aa23e
plugins: call load_wallet in install wizard
2015-06-10 12:40:08 +02:00
Neil Booth
a3ad32bd91
Use requests instead - SSL handling is superior
2015-06-10 16:15:00 +09:00
ThomasV
479a6f84e7
paymentrequest: add headers to http request
2015-06-10 09:04:34 +02:00
ThomasV
8bccf7b2db
replace httplib with requests
2015-06-10 08:29:50 +02:00
ThomasV
ee6b718ea4
better message
2015-06-09 16:10:44 +02:00
ThomasV
f70a996619
fix trezor initialiation hook (pass window in load_wallet)
2015-06-09 09:58:40 +02:00
Neil Booth
e8db8983ec
Make the synchronizer not a thread.
...
The synchronizer's work is done from the network proxy's main loop.
A minor problem with the old synchronizer was that it considered itself
out of date if the network was out of date. This was too generic: the
network can have pending requests unrelated to the synchronizer. This
resulted in the synchronizer often unnecessarily flipping the wallet
between up-to-date and not-up-to-date, and causing unnecessary calls
to wallet.save_transactions(). This was observable when opening the
network dialog box: frequently just opening it would cause a wallet
status change and transaction flush, simply because the network dialog
sends a get_parameters() request. This rework of the synchronizer does
not have that issue.
2015-06-09 08:41:31 +09:00
ThomasV
70037b89a9
version 2.3 and release notes
2015-06-08 18:40:21 +02:00
ThomasV
8995cdbf14
rename fields: 'time' -> 'timestamp', payment_requests
2015-06-08 13:36:35 +02:00
ThomasV
357c405ac6
fix publish_request
2015-06-08 13:21:13 +02:00
ThomasV
d367930113
amount is in satoshis
2015-06-08 13:20:42 +02:00
ThomasV
9bd94e5062
refactor payment requests
2015-06-08 12:51:45 +02:00